Jargon Buster "IDE"

 

IDE - Integrated Drive Electronics

A type of PC hard disk, now obsolete, the foreunner of EIDE.

IDE was adopted as a standard by American National Standards Institute (ANSI) in November, 1990. The ANSI name for IDE is Advanced Technology Attachment (ATA). The IDE (ATA) standard is one of several related standards maintained by the T10 Committee.
